Psychiatric disorders


This week,I began training on a psychiatric ward with one of my professors for a month.Week one was really interesting but more eye-opening.Due to the fact that I had moments of depression growing up,I am very compassionate towards those who are diagnosed with mental disorders.

Depression can affect anyone at any point in life.There are many factors that can cause depression but according to experts and scientists,there is a chemical imbalance in the brain.The chemicals that are imbalanced are called neurotransmitters (NTs).The main types of NTs involved in depression are norepinephrine (NE), serotonin (5-HT) and dopamine (DA).Genetics also plays a role in these disorders.I know your brain probably hurts from all the terminology but understanding the cause of a problem can actually help fix the problem.

I believe that I’m being trained on a psychiatric ward to expand my knowledge as an intern pharmacist but to also be a blessing.The interesting thing about the psych patients I have met thus far is that most of them look normal.Psychiatric disorders such as depression, bipolar disorder, anxiety and substance abuse are not detectable to the naked eyes.We all know people who are hurting inside but they are smiling on the outside. So people need to be diagnosed by psychiatrists because if left untreated, death can occur.
